Jesse Nakooka

Maui entertainer, Jesse Kealoha Nako’oka .was born in Lahaina, Maui on November 13, 1943, and we lost him in Olinda, Maui on October 13, 2007.
We’ll follow Jesse’s musical path all the way to the Maui Lu Resort where he o-hosted the “Aloha Mele Luncheon” series with Aunty Emma Sharpe.
We’ll remember one of Maui’s finest sons, with his many musical pals, his featured venues, and his final life’s work.
